tab width printing for subtasks
This commit is contained in:
parent
ad557e822f
commit
e90ec3e647
|
|
@ -15,7 +15,6 @@ pub struct TaskGroup {
|
||||||
pub struct Task {
|
pub struct Task {
|
||||||
pub status: Status,
|
pub status: Status,
|
||||||
pub text: String,
|
pub text: String,
|
||||||
// level: u8,
|
|
||||||
pub subtasks: Option<Vec<Task>>,
|
pub subtasks: Option<Vec<Task>>,
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
@ -89,10 +88,10 @@ impl ToString for Task {
|
||||||
};
|
};
|
||||||
|
|
||||||
format!(
|
format!(
|
||||||
" - [{}] {}{}\n",
|
"- [{}] {}{}\n",
|
||||||
ch,
|
ch,
|
||||||
self.text.trim(),
|
self.text.trim(),
|
||||||
subtasks.replace("\n", "\n ")
|
subtasks.replace("\n", "\n ")
|
||||||
)
|
)
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
@ -133,7 +132,6 @@ impl<'a> TryFrom<&'a AstNode<'a>> for Task {
|
||||||
status,
|
status,
|
||||||
text,
|
text,
|
||||||
subtasks,
|
subtasks,
|
||||||
// level: 1,
|
|
||||||
})
|
})
|
||||||
} else {
|
} else {
|
||||||
Err(TaskError::ParsingError(
|
Err(TaskError::ParsingError(
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ue